The two-component model of the cosmic medium consists of (1) a moving background plasma with a frozen-in magnetic field and (2) an ensemble of magnetic clouds moving at a velocity that differs from that of the background plasma. Cosmic-ray energy losses in this model are considered; the propagation of electrons in the interstellar medium is considered as an example.
